How do I delete the corresponding row?

  • Hi all,

    I have a problem.  I have the following script which deletes two kinds of duplicates - ones where there are 2 or more rows with the same keys, and ones where there are 2 or more rows of duplicates according to business rules.  The problem I have is that I also need to delete the corresponding row on another table, but this is proving difficult.  The script selects the duplicates, then subtracts 1 from rowcount and then does the delete.  This way all but 1 of the duplicates is deleted.  The problem is that I do not know which row is left behind and cannot therefore identify the corresponding row to delete.  I cannot select the key of the corresponding row when I select the duplicates as this field would make each row uniqe and therefore it would not appear in my duplicates list (each row on sickness has an individual sickid).   The tables look like this:

    Sickness                      SicknessDays

    payroll                         sickid

    staffid                         other details.... 

    start date

    end date

    sickid

    And here is the script:

    /*Delete complete duplicates from Sickness table*/

    Declare @payroll varchar(8),

     @staff_id int,

            @start_date datetime,

            @end_date datetime,

     @cnt int

    Declare getfullrecords cursor local static For

     Select count (1), payroll, staff_id, start_date, end_date

       from sickness (nolock)

       group by payroll, staff_id, start_date, end_date having count(1)>1

     

     

    Open getfullrecords

    Fetch next from getfullrecords into @cnt,@payroll,@staff_id,@start_date, @end_date

    --Cursor to check with all other records

    While @@fetch_status=0

     Begin

      Set @cnt= @cnt-1

      Set rowcount @cnt

      Delete from sickness where payroll = @payroll and staff_id = @staff_id

      and start_date = @start_date and end_date = @end_date

    --Delete the corresponding rec from sicknessdays but how to find it?  Link is sickid - not retrieved.

       

      Set rowcount 0

      Fetch next from getfullrecords into @cnt, @payroll, @staff_id, @start_date, @end_date

     End

    Close getfullrecords

    Deallocate getfullrecords

  • Hmm... quite complicated, not sure whether I haven't missed something... what about this (I will write as I'm thinking, so that you can follow my reasoning and decide whether I'm not completely off topic):

    1. get the sickid of all records that should not be deleted (say, the one with lowest sickid for every dupe group)

    select payroll, staffid, start_date, end_date, min(sickid)

    from sickness

    group by payroll, staffid, start_date, end_date

    2. get the sickid of records that should be deleted (=other than those in the previous step)

    SELECT s.sickid

    FROM sickness s

    LEFT JOIN

    (select payroll, staffid, start_date, end_date, min(sickid)

    from sickness

    group by payroll, staffid, start_date, end_date) AS ok ON ok.sickid = s.sickid

    WHERE ok.sickid IS NULL

    3. now you have a list of all the sickid that you will delete, and you can also delete any corresponding records.

    Would this work on your DB, or have I missed something?
